What Is the Lamborghini Revuelto?
The Revuelto is Lamborghini’s next-generation flagship supercar. It replaces the iconic Aventador and introduces a new hybrid architecture designed to meet modern performance and efficiency demands while staying true to Lamborghini’s aggressive DNA.
Key highlights include:
- First Lamborghini supercar with a hybrid powertrain
- Retains a high-revving naturally aspirated V12 engine
- Uses electric motors to boost performance, not reduce excitement
- Designed as a bridge between classic supercars and the electrified future

Hybrid Powertrain Explained
At the heart of the Revuelto is a sophisticated hybrid setup that combines traditional power with modern technology.
Powertrain details:
- 6.5-litre naturally aspirated V12 petrol engine
- Three electric motors integrated into the system
- Combined power output exceeding 1,000 bhp
- All-wheel-drive configuration for maximum traction
- 8-speed dual-clutch automatic transmission
Unlike conventional hybrids focused mainly on efficiency, the Revuelto uses electrification to sharpen performance, improve torque delivery, and enhance handling.

Driving Modes and Technology
The Revuelto offers multiple driving modes that allow drivers to adjust the car’s behavior based on road conditions and driving style.
Key driving features:
- Electric-only mode for silent low-speed driving
- Hybrid mode for balanced performance and efficiency
- Performance-focused modes for track and spirited driving
- Intelligent energy recovery during braking
Inside the cabin, the Revuelto features a modern, driver-focused layout with digital displays and intuitive controls, keeping the focus firmly on driving.
